"It's Been Awhile" is a song by rock band Staind. It was released on March 27, 2001, as the lead single from their third studio album, Break the Cycle (2001). The song is Staind's most successful and is their best-known song, becoming a #5 hit on the Billboard Hot 100 in October 2001—their only song to reach the top 10. It spent a second-best 20 weeks at #1 on the Billboard Mainstream Rock Tracks chart (behind "Loser" by 3 Doors Down) and a then-record 16 weeks at #1 on the Billboard Hot Modern Rock Tracks chart. Staind is an metal band formed on November 24, 1995 in Springfield, Massachusetts, United States. After meeting through friends and covering pop hits of the day in smalltime clubs for a year and a half, Staind self-released their debut album, Tormented, in November 1996, citing influences in brutal latin thrash metal. Until recently, the album was difficult to obtain, as only four thousand copies were originally sold. Since then, the band's official website has released the album to meet the demand from fans.
